This doesn't seem to belong anywhere else but just to let everyone know --


my step-brother is working temprorarily to help install a few megawatt-size mills in the township of Bliss, NY. It's roughly on the state line between NY PA and Ohio, catching the wind from the south eastern shores of the lakes. He's running a hundred foot crane or ther abouts.


I don't know a lot of details (please don't ask) but I do know that the township was fairly divided over it. Based on prior experience in the Great Plains it is likely that these are the GE/FANUC mills being sold back into the grid.

Rock Port, Missouri, made the recent CNN news! they are not a big town , but the reason for making the news is that they now get ALL their power from wind . They have backup system in place too, but have not had to use it since turning it on.
